Michigan divides CSC into four degrees under MCL 750.520 b–e. Although each charge is unique, every accusation hinges on two core questions: (1) sexual penetration versus contact, and (2) aggravating factors such as force, age, relationship, injury, or incapacity.
Each degree can trigger sex-offender registration for 15 years, 25 years, or life, depending on statutory tiering. A negotiated reduction from first or third degree to fourth degree can shave decades off potential incarceration and eliminate lifetime listing.

CSC felonies originating in Ann Arbor begin with a sworn complaint in the 15th District Court (Justice Center on East Huron Street) for arraignment and probable-cause conference. Unless resolved, the file is bound over to the 22nd Circuit Court at the Washtenaw County Trial Court complex on Main Street for motion practice, plea negotiations, and, if necessary, jury trial before a circuit-court judge.
